
A Chicken Finger Salad is a hearty, American-style salad that combines crispy, breaded chicken tenders with a base of mixed greens, cherry tomatoes, cucumbers, and often cheese or croutons. It's a popular casual dining or pub grub dish, offering a satisfying mix of textures and flavors.

This salad is typically high in protein from the chicken and can be moderate to high in fat, depending on the dressing and cheese. A standard serving generally provides a good source of protein and some vitamins from the vegetables, with a calorie range often between 500-800 calories.
